There is room for improvement in every life. Regardless of our occupations, regardless of our circumstances, we can improve ourselves and while so doing have an effect on the lives of those about us.
Gordon B. Hinckley
ShareWTF𝕏

Interpretation

What this quote means

Everyone has the potential to grow and better themselves, influencing others positively in the process.

This quote emphasizes the universal potential for personal growth that exists in every individual, regardless of their current situation or job. It asserts that self-improvement not only enhances one's own life but also positively impacts those around us, creating a ripple effect of positivity and growth in the community.
